Grenache is back in a big way baby - thanks largely to modern takes on Australia's traditional fortified workhorse. Andrew "Ox" Hardy's family has generations of experience with the variety in McLaren Vale, where it thrives in the warmth. The fruit for this impressive drop was sourced from three different vineyards, all planted 40-50 years ago. There is a lot of depth of flavour here, but also a deftness to the winemaking with the end result a flavoursome red that is immediately accessible. Hard picked, part whole bunch, unfined, unfiltered and perfect for an autumn barbecue. Soft and floral but with crisp acid on the palate. Good value here for $30. https://oxhardywines.com.au/
